← Nature & AnimalsWhich developmental abnormality occurs when imaginal disc cells experience ectopic activation of homeotic genes?
A)Limb replacement with antennal structures✓
B)Accelerated molting before complete differentiation
C)Blocked apoptosis leading to unsegmented limbs
D)Reduced number of ommatidia forming deformed eyes
💡 Explanation
When homeotic genes are ectopically activated in imaginal discs, positional information is disrupted because these genes specify segment identity, causing cells to adopt the fate of another segment, leading to a limb replacement. Therefore, antennal structures replace limbs rather than accelerated molting needing hormonal control, blocked apoptosis disturbing cell death, or reduced ommatidia numbers resulting from separate signalling pathway disruptions.
